I just got into succulents about a year ago. I joined a succulent lovers club and also read and watch videos on caring for them. My club members all seem to follow the same path but I get a lot of conflicting information online. You just answered some of my questions that I haven’t found a straight answer to before. I like that you give thorough advice as you show us what you’re doing. You just answered why you shouldn’t repot new succulents as soon as you get them and either pot dry succulents in wet soil or wet succulents in dry soil and never water them before 8 days to 2 weeks. I’ve asked others before about repotting plants I receive from online sites. I don’t have any local nurseries here. A lot of the ones I receive are blooming and/or have pups. I’ve had answers such as go ahead and repot them or at the other end not to disturb them then. That’s what I thought and you confirmed that. I have a lot of questions but one I really need to know now, because I’m potting some that I got a couple of weeks ago and repotting ones that have seriously outgrown their original small pots. I see that you don’t remove all of the soil on the roots when potting new plants. I’ve mostly been told to remove as much of the soil as possible even to washing the roots. But I’ve seen growers who think that as long as the soil is not too wet or doesn’t look too good, it’s ok to leave some or all of the soil on the roots that they’ve been growing in. I see some that come in soil that looks good and they’ve obviously been thriving in so I feel like I should leave their soil on and pot the plants with their soil into new soil that’s recommended but also resembles what their original soil is. I learned to use a gritty soil mix with my cacti and my succulents that are mostly Crassula, Haworthia, Gasteria and ice plants. I don’t do well with thin leafed succulents like a lot of Echeveria. Hello Laureen, thank you so much for the long messages! I really appreciate them. I love all the details. I do think you’re on the right track with everything. It’s quite true that most of it just takes some common sense and a little digging here and there. That’s referring to info that’s available online. I don’t suggest to strip all the soil off the roots or even wash them all off. I feel like it’s too much unnecessary work. I have always left some soil and my plants have been doing fine. I guess, people would say to remove all the old soil with the idea that those soil have already been stripped of all nutrients which could also be true, but then, as long as there’s more newer, fresher soil around it, I don’t think there would really be a problem. The plant can always grow more roots so that it can access the more fertile soil. So stripping away ALL the old soil is just overkill. I honestly think either way works.
